Running systems should have wiring rules
The process wiring to the High-Performance Process Manager should be segregated by signal level in different trays or conduits to minimize cross talk. The segregation rules are as follows:
Millivolt signals from electrical components, such as thermocouples, low voltage dc signals, 1-5 V/4-20 mA, and digital/contact circuits with voltages less than 30 Vac peak/DC, should be in individual cables that provide a protective shield. They can all be routed in the same cable tray. The tray can also include UCN coaxial cables, Master Reference Ground cables (Safety Ground cables in a CE Compliant installation) cables, and 50-conductor FTA to IOP cables.
Circuits running at higher voltages, or nonshielded circuits at any voltage, belong in their own metal tray compartment or conduit. Thermocouple signals with a common mode of over 30 Vdc are also in this latter category.
Wiring to Galvanically Isolated FTA must be separated from all other wiring. More information can be found in the High-Performance Process Manager Installation, Process Manager I/O Installation, or the TPS System Site Planning manuals.
